    fork seals question

    I orderd oem fork seals from bike bandit. I recieved them today only the part number is 41y-23145-00. It is the same number except on the original part number shows to be 2H7-23145-00. The only difference in the seals are that the new ones have an extra spring on the upper lip. Will these work for my 80G(air forks)? I think that they will, but before I put them in, I want to make sure.
